South Carolina State University seeks an innovative, entrepreneurial, and visionary leader to serve as the Executive Director of the BECT Institute. The Executive Director is responsible for advancing its mission of excellence in education, research, workforce development, innovation, entrepreneurship, and community engagement in business, environment, communication, transportation and technology-related disciplines. BECT’s mission is to develop and implement programs that strengthen academic excellence, expand research and sponsored activities, foster industry partnerships, and support student success.

The Executive Director of the BECT Institute will play a critical role in shaping the future of student success in research, innovation and entrepreneurship at South Carolina State University. Through visionary leadership, strategic partnerships, and transformative programming, the Executive Director will help prepare the next generation, strengthen the regional economy, and elevate the University’s role as a driver of research, innovation and economic opportunity.

The Executive Director will serve as the catalyst to expand the Institute’s capacity to identify experiential learning opportunities, develop partnerships, and secure resources to prepare students for the workplace.

The Executive Director will collaborate across academic colleges, administrative units, industry partners, government agencies, investors, and community organizations to position the BECT Institute as a recognized leader in enhancing the career readiness of students.

Key Responsibilities

  • Develop and execute a comprehensive strategic plan for the BECT Institute aligned with the mission and priorities of South Carolina State University.
  • Expand research activities and interdisciplinary collaborations related to business, engineering, computing, and technology fields.
  • Build a culture of innovation, creativity, collaboration, and entrepreneurial thinking across the University
  • Develop and promote collaborative projects that support workforce readiness for students and economic development
  • Promote interdisciplinary collaboration among academic programs and external partners.
  • Develop programs that prepare students for careers in high-demand sectors and emerging industries. Support student research, innovation, entrepreneurship, and leadership development activities.
  • Strengthen the University’s role as an economic development partner for Orangeburg and surrounding communities.
  • Identify and pursue external funding opportunities including grants, sponsorships, corporate partnerships, and philanthropic support.
  • Manage budgets, resources, and investments to maximize program impact and sustainability.
  • Provide effective management of Institute operations, staff, budgets, and strategic initiatives.
  • Prepare reports and presentations for university leadership and stakeholders.

Minimum Requirements For Entry Into Position

  • Master’s degree required

Preferred Requirements For Entry Into Position

  • Doctoral degree preferred in business, entrepreneurship, education, economic development, innovation, or related field.
  • Demonstrated ability to work collaboratively with diverse stakeholders
